Operation: How do you replace the diesel filter on the Mini Countryman?

To be able to replace the diesel filter on the Mini Countryman you need to access the lower part of the vehicle, in correspondence with the engine compartment: here there will be a plastic cover that protects the lower part of the engine, which must be removed by unscrewing the screws. Once this has been removed, it will be possible to access the fuel filter which must be released from its fastening screws; therefore the cables connected to the filter will also have to be disconnected and this can be completely removed, replacing it with a new one. After the replacement, the corresponding plastic cover can be reassembled.

How do you reset the AdBlue warning light on the Dacia Duster?

The AdBlue warning light on the Dacia Duster appears on the instrument panel when the additional fluid level inside the special tank is low and it is necessary to top up. To do this, you will need to open the fuel flap and unscrew the cap next to that of the fuel tank. Then it will be possible to put the additional liquid inside the tank, until it is completely filled. In this way, it will be possible to verify that the AdBlue warning light has disappeared from the instrument panel: if the warning light stays on, it is likely that the sensor does not detect the liquid as this has a low concentration of urea.
